14:22 — On-call confirmed that the Pixelwash EXIF scrubbing worker had been skipping orientation and GPS tags on HEIC uploads since the 09:40 deploy. Affected images were quarantined and re-queued through the scrubber. Root cause: a parser flag regression in the metadata library bump. Mitigation verified on canary at 14:50. The deploy that introduced the regression is identified by the trace token below.

session token of tajef-bageg = htk21_5d90d574934f3ccae6437

Runbook: Refreshing the Lintgate Baseline

When Lintgate reports a wall of pre-existing findings after a rule upgrade, do not suppress inline. Regenerate the baseline file via the refresh task, review the diff for accidentally silenced new findings, and commit baseline-only changes separately. Never hand-edit entries. CI enforces that the baseline hash matches the generator output. Record the regeneration against the build token below.

trace token, tawep-fahif: htk3_b58

Management Meeting Minutes — Project Skylark Delay

Quick summary for sales leads: Skylark slips another six weeks, so don't promise the new dashboard to prospects before autumn. Blame sits with integration testing, not scope creep. Marla's team will circulate revised demo materials. Hold current pricing talking points. The confidential direction we're taking is noted below.

management briefing: The pricing group signed off on a budget of $378.8 million for Project Kasael.

Subject: Capacity Decision — Arlowe Components. Dear heads of department, following careful review of demand projections for the Merrivale line, the executive team has approved adding a second assembly cell at the Corsdale plant rather than outsourcing. Tooling orders begin next week; staffing plans will follow from each department. Please review the attached phasing schedule carefully. The confidential note on our business plans follows below.

internal memo for yahag-tahog: The pricing group signed off on a budget of $152.8 million for Project Soriel.